Mississippi RB targets visits

Brandon (Miss.) running back

Bobby Weakley says he's working
on finalizing four official visit dates.
"I'm looking at Ole Miss, Mississippi State, Kentucky
and Southern Miss right now." he said. "Those are the four I've had calls from
lately. I'm also thinking about Auburn or LSU. I need to hurry up and get them
set up. I know time is kind of running out, but I've been working a lot lately
and not had a chance to talk to a bunch of coaches when they've called the
house."
Is there a favorite in the mix?
"Probably Ole Miss," he said. "I like their reputation
for developing good running backs. I really liked the campus, too, when I went
up there for a game this season. It was beautiful."
Weakley (6-0, 211, 4.5) rushed for more than 1,000 yards
and 10 touchdowns this season after assuming the featured back role for Brandon.
As a junior, he amassed 422 yards playing the backup role to All-American
Jerious Norwood, now a freshman at Mississippi State.
He may also be recruited to play defense, perhaps as an
outside linebacker or safety in certain schemes.
